Crispin Court Care Home, located in Staffordshire, stands among eight Avery Healthcare homes in the county. Acknowledgements of its exceptional facilities and services come from residents and their families and the Care Quality Commission, which has recognised it as Outstanding (May 2020).

Review from Anthony W (Son of Resident) published on 14 December 2016 Submitted via Website
Overall Experience

It is an amazing environment with five star surroundings. The staff are extremely attentive and understand the needs and problems of both the residents and family. Lots going on to stimulate the residents. Residents can join in the activities or decline as they wish, no pressure is placed on them. Everything is geared to the welfare and well-being of the residents which in turn creates peace of mind for the family. The food is excellent with a good choice and served in a relaxed setting.

Claire Grujich
Claire GrujichJob Title:Home AdministratorJoined: 2016

Claire has over 20 years of experience in the care industry, primarily working as a senior carer in care homes. Claire joined the team at Crispin Court back in 2016. She started working nights as a senior carer before she was promoted to team leader on days. Claire wanted a new challenge back in 2021 and was offered the position of home administrator.

Claire supports the Home Manager with payroll, contracts for staff and residents, recruitment, and she deals with the finances. If you have any questions regarding finances, Claire is happy to help.
